GRANTQUICK SUMMARYPlain-English Overview

Small Surface Water and Groundwater Storage Projects (Small Storage Program). Bureau of Reclamation. This Notice of Funding Opportunity and closing date are paused and under review until further notice. up to $30,000,000 per award; $43,500,000 total program funding.
